Wong > > > > > > I was poking around in the directory code while diagnosing online fsck > > > bugs, and noticed that xfs_readdir doesn't actually take the directory > > > ILOCK when it calls xfs_dir2_isblock. xfs_dir_open most probably loaded > > > the data fork mappings > > > > Yup, that is pretty much guaranteed. If the inode is extent or btree form as the > > extent count will be non-zero, hence we can only get to the > > xfs_dir2_isblock() check if the inode has moved from local to block > > form between the open and xfs_dir2_isblock() get in the getdents > > code. > > > > > and the VFS took i_rwsem (aka IOLOCK_SHARED) so > > > we're protected against writer threads, but we really need to follow the > > > locking model like we do in other places. The same applies to the > > > shortform getdents function. > > > > Locking rules should be the same as xfs_dir_lookup()..... > > Ok, I assumed the locking in xfs_dir_lookup() is optimal.... > > .... which it turns out it isn't. All calls to xfs_dir_lookup() > occur with the directory locked at the VFS level, so the internal > contents of the directory can never change during a lookup. Hence > holding the ILOCK across the entire lookup is both unnecessary and > excessive. > > What xfs_dir_lookup() should be doing is what xfs_readdir() is > largely already doing - just locking the ILOCK around buffer read > operations when we are mapping directory offsets to physical disk > locations and reading them from disk. Changing this is a > significant set of changes, so it's not something that needs to be > done right now. > > However, we still need to protect the xfs_dir2_isblock() lookup call > in xfs_readdir(). > > > > While we're at it, clean up the somewhat strange structure of this > > > function. > > > > > > Signed-off-by: Darrick J.
